Description
This versatile 487 +/- acre property near Ida May in Lee County, Kentucky, offers an uncommon combination of extensive access, existing infrastructure, blue-line streams, diverse terrain, and large recreational acreage and development potential, all located less than 2 miles from Daniel Boone National Forest to the west and a short drive from the Red River Gorge to the north. The property has approximately 3,000 feet of frontage along KY 587 on the southern boundary with two gated entrances, approximately 2,500 feet of blacktop frontage along KY 399 at the northern boundary with a gated entrance, plus an approximately 1,600-foot easement providing additional access from Hamilton Ridge Road into the western portion of the property. This massive tract of land has approximately 2,300 feet of Duck Fork Creek crossing the northern portion before joining Sturgeon Creek near the northwest corner. In comparison, approximately 3,800 feet of Willis Branch Creek runs through the central part of the property, providing more than a mile of combined blue-line streams. Elevations range from approximately 628 feet along the creek to 1,080 feet at the highest point, with a diverse mix of creek bottoms, wooded ridges, large, flatter ridges and plateau areas, hollows, drainages, and rugged, gorge-like terrain. Several miles of established trails and internal roads provide access throughout the property, with an extensive drivable road system serving the southern acreage and improvements. Two 30x50 metal pole-barn-style buildings with lean-tos feature concrete floors, full utilities, and climate-controlled living space, while multiple smaller structures provide additional storage and other uses. The property also has three recently installed, separate septic systems and underground electrical lines extending through a substantial portion of the southeastern area of the property. A recently drilled well is present but provides only non-potable water at this time. The varied terrain, creek corridors, mature timber stands, and numerous habitat transitions provide opportunities for hunting, wildlife management, hiking, ATV riding, and other outdoor recreational activities. At the same time, le the nearby Daniel Boone National Forest expands those recreational opportunities into the surrounding area. Beyond recreation, the combination of nearly 5,500 feet of blacktop frontage on two state highways, multiple access points, substantial usable ridge and plateau ground, existing buildings, utilities, septic systems, internal roads, and nearly 500 contiguous acres creates potential for residential, cabin,n or recreational development, subject to applicable regulations and site evaluations. This property offers the scale and natural features of a large Eastern Kentucky recreational Mecca while providing existing infrastructure, multiple access options, and proximity to Daniel Boone National Forest.
